How to fill out campaign finance disclosure reports

How to fill out campaign finance disclosure reports
01
To fill out campaign finance disclosure reports, follow these steps:
02
Gather all relevant financial information related to your campaign, including contributions received, expenditures made, loans received, and debts incurred.
03
Determine the reporting period for which you need to file the disclosure report, usually on a quarterly or annual basis.
04
Consult the rules and regulations set forth by the election board or governmental agency responsible for campaign finance reporting in your jurisdiction.
05
Use the prescribed forms or templates provided by the regulatory body to ensure compliance with reporting requirements.
06
Enter all financial transactions accurately and comprehensively, providing details such as the date, amount, purpose, and source/recipient of each transaction.
07
Classify the transactions properly according to the predetermined categories provided in the reporting form, such as contributions, expenses, loans, or debts.
08
Calculate the total income and expenditure for the reporting period and prepare a summary or balance sheet.
09
Reconcile any discrepancies, if applicable, and ensure the accuracy and integrity of the reported financial information.
10
Sign and certify the disclosure report, acknowledging that the information provided is true and complete to the best of your knowledge.
11
Submit the report within the specified deadline, either electronically or in hard copy, as per the instructions provided by the regulatory body.
12
Keep a copy of the filed report for your records and be prepared to provide additional information or supporting documents if requested for auditing or review purposes.
Who needs campaign finance disclosure reports?
01
Campaign finance disclosure reports are required by individuals or entities involved in political campaigns or activities that involve raising funds or making expenditures to support or oppose a candidate, ballot measure, or political party.
02
This typically includes candidates running for public office, political action committees (PACs), super PACs, party committees, and other organizations or individuals that engage in campaign financing.
03
The purpose of these reports is to promote transparency and accountability, allowing the public to track the flow of money in politics, identify potential conflicts of interest, and ensure compliance with campaign finance laws.

What is campaign finance disclosure reports?
Campaign finance disclosure reports are documents filed by candidates, political parties, and political committees that provide detailed information about the funds they raise and spend during an election cycle.
Who is required to file campaign finance disclosure reports?
Candidates for federal office, political parties, and political action committees (PACs) are generally required to file campaign finance disclosure reports.
How to fill out campaign finance disclosure reports?
To fill out campaign finance disclosure reports, candidates and committees must collect and record all contributions received and expenses incurred, follow the prescribed format provided by the Federal Election Commission (FEC) or state regulatory agencies, and submit the reports by the required deadlines.
What is the purpose of campaign finance disclosure reports?
The purpose of campaign finance disclosure reports is to promote transparency in the electoral process by providing the public with information about who is funding political campaigns and how campaign funds are being spent.
What information must be reported on campaign finance disclosure reports?
Campaign finance disclosure reports must include information about contributions received (including donor names and amounts), expenditures made, debts owed, and the overall financial status of the campaign.
